Sale 1011, Lot 1752, Confederate States (Trans-Mississippi Express, Blockade Mail, Groups)Blockade Run, Savannah Ga. to Rome (Italy) via Charleston and Nassau. Docketed "Sav." on cover to Mrs, John Lorenzo Locke in Rome, in care of Baring Brothers, entered mails with Liverpool ship letter marking Sep. 6 (long trip), "6" pence ship fee, carried by the blockade-runner Minnie, departing Wilmington Apr. 11, 1864, arriving St. George's Apr. 15, then by a non-contract ship to England, Baring Bros. sent under cover to Rome, the Minnie was owned by the Albion Trading Co. and was active Jan. to May 1864, it was 3 for 4 in successful trips and was captured by the U.S.S. Connecticut on May 9, 1864, coming out of Wilmington
